  • Patent number: 6039226
    Abstract: The spare tire mount is adapted for use in a pickup truck including a bed having a floor with ribs and grooves running from front to back, and vertically upstanding side walls connected, at their upper edges, to inwardly extending horizontal flanges. The spare tire mount includes a lower unit having a base which rests on the floor of the pickup truck bed and which supports a post. An upper unit fits vertically adjustably over the post and has a bracket which, when the upper unit is adjusted vertically upward, pushes against the horizontal flange of the bed. Securing means are provided for maintaining the base and bracket in snug contact with the floor and horizontal flange, respectively. The upper unit supports means for securing the tire to the spare tire mount. The tire, when secured to the spare tire mount, rests on the base for additional stability.

  • Patent number: 4531346
    Abstract: A stirrup stay for adjusting the horizontal angle of a horse saddle stirrup is constructed from a strip of sheet material that is adapted to be received in the space between the inner and outer portions of a stirrup strap and resting in the loop at the bottom of the strap. The strip of sheet material is hand-deformable by twisting to selectively impart the desired degree of twist to the stirrup strap. The strip may be formed from sheet metal having a cushioning coating protecting a majority of the edges. In one embodiment, a sheet metal strip is bent by 180 degrees near its center to bring opposite longitudinal ends together, and the opposite halves of the strip are covered by a sheath of leather, rubber, or other yieldable material. A central portion of the strip near the bend may remain uncovered and is protected, in use, by placement of the stirrup with its pivot pin resting in the bend.
